Effective Respiratory Infection Solutions in Moinabad .

Respiratory infections, impacting airways and lungs, manifest through symptoms such as cough, fever, and breathing issues. In Moinabad, skilled specialists provide evidence-based care utilizing cutting-edge diagnostics and contemporary therapies. Regardless of whether the infection is bacterial, viral, or fungal, prompt and precise treatment is crucial to avoid complications. The majority of patients show positive responses to specific medications and supportive care, typically returning to their regular activities within a few days.

Factors leading to respiratory infection development.

Airway invasion by viruses, bacteria, or fungi causes respiratory infections. Contributing factors encompass compromised immunity, pollutant exposure, and proximity to infected persons.

Influenza and rhinovirus are frequent causes of upper and lower respiratory infections.

At-Risk Individuals?

Some groups face higher risks from respiratory infections and may require immediate medical care.

Children with young age

Children with young age

Infants and toddlers, with developing immune systems, are highly susceptible to infections.

Elderly individuals

Elderly individuals

Adults over 65, with weakened immunity, face increased risk of severe respiratory illness.

Patients with chronic conditions

Patients with chronic conditions

Those with asthma, COPD, or diabetes face higher risks of complications from respiratory infections.

Individuals with weakened immunity

Individuals with weakened immunity

People on immunosuppressants or with HIV are more prone to serious respiratory complications.

Potential issues

Severe or untreated respiratory infections can cause serious complications needing quick medical care.

Lung infection: Pneumonia.

Lung infection: Pneumonia.

Pneumonia, a lung infection, occurs when bacteria spread into lung tissue, causing breathing issues and possible hospitalization.

Long-term airway inflammation.

Long-term airway inflammation.

Chronic bronchitis involves long-term airway inflammation from repeated infections, leading to persistent cough and reduced lung function.

Infection-related sepsis.

Infection-related sepsis.

In susceptible individuals, infections can enter the bloodstream, leading to sepsis, a critical condition.

Guard yourself: Prevention is your top defense.

Adopting straightforward daily routines can markedly reduce respiratory infection risks.

Practice Hand Hygiene

Practice Hand Hygiene

Regularly wash hands with soap for 20 seconds to eliminate pathogens.

Keep Vaccinations Up-to-Date

Keep Vaccinations Up-to-Date

Yearly flu and pneumonia shots provide robust defense against infections.

Minimize Close Contact

Minimize Close Contact

Keep distance from those infected to lower transmission chances.

Enhance Immune System

Enhance Immune System

Consume balanced diets, ensure good sleep, and exercise for stronger immunity.
